The World University Service Canada (WUSC) and supported by the National Chamber of Commerce will conduct a CSR session on October 18 from 2.00 p.m to 5.00 p.m at the National Chamber Auditorium 450 D R Wijewardene Mawatha Colombo – 10.
The main facilitator at these seminars will be Steven Fish, a renowned Canadian CSR coach and Executive Director of Canadian Business for Social Responsibility (CBSR). These evening seminars would help participating companies and organizations achieve accelerated social impact and encourage to rewire their businesses to achieve greater financial growth .
These series of evening seminars will be held from 17th to 20th of October. On 17th October, for the tourism and hospitality sector at the SLITHM auditorium from 2 pm- 5pm. On 18th October, at the National Chamber Auditorium from 2 pm - 5 pm for those involved in the ICT industry on 19th October , DIMO Auditorium from 2:30 p.m. to 4:30, for the automotive industry. The final one on 20th Oct at BMICH from 2 pm onwards for the construction industry.
